This paper, published in 2004, received 846 indexed citations. Written by Minqing Hu and Bing Liu covering the research area of Artificial Intelligence and Information Systems. It is primarily cited by scholars working on Artificial Intelligence (747 citations), Information Systems (243 citations) and Sociology and Political Science (174 citations). Published in National Conference on Artificial Intelligence.
